catpack68 Posted March 23, 2015 Posted March 23, 2015 Here is another one I finished about 2yrs.I started a WIP thread on this one awhile back,but I could not find it.I used the Revell 69 Yenko kit.The standard SS hood is from the old 69 MPC Camaro kit.The paint is Testors fathom green lacquer and the clear is Testors wet look .The stripes and emblems came from the Revell 69 Camaro SS convertible kit decal sheet.The wheels and tires are the Revell 69 COPO Nova kit.The tire decals are from my decal stash. The engine was wired and detailed.i painted the heads krylon aluminum as i wanted to do RPO L-89 optioned aluminum headed Camaro.i made a alternator bracket.The interior has Model Car Garage photoetched buckles,masking tape seat belts and i used embossing powder for the carpet.thanks for looking.
